Most role playing gamers appreciate good rpg accessories. Not only can accessories add to the excitement of a particular game, they can assist in actual game play mechanics as well. Wizards of the Coast, the publisher of Dungeons and Dragons, is planning a March 20, 2012 release date for the Cathedral of Chaos: Dungeon Tiles role playing game accessory. This particular set of dungeon tiles includes not only four illustrated cardstock terrain tiles, but two sheets of magical spell, trap and elemental hazard tokens. Like other previously released sets in the dungeon tile series, The Cathedral of Chaos offers an easy, affordable solution for Dungeon Masters wishing to add colorful terrain to the table top. The tiles are configurable and can be arranged in many different ways, allowing Dungeon Masters the means to build unique D&D encounter locations for player characters.
